When can I expect good weather in Pauillac?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Pauillac rel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 8°C. Average annual precipitation for Pauillac is 827 mm.
What's there to see and do in Pauillac?
Experience Pauillac with a stop at Château Lynch-Bages, Château Pontet-Canet and Château Mouton Rothschild. If you have a bit of extra time while you're in the area, you might want to check out Château Latour and Château Lafite Rothschild.
